Baked bell peppers provide a single dish meal packed with sausage, rice, Parmesan cheese, and Italian seasonings.
Prep Time15 minutesmins
Cook Time30 minutesmins
Total Time45 minutesmins
Servings: 6
Author: Adapted from Chili Pepper Madness Easy Italian Sausage Stuffed Peppers
Ingredients
1tbsp olive oil
1small onion, chopped
2clovesgarlic, minced
1 1/4lbmild Italian sausage
3/4cupshredded Parmesan cheese
1 1/2cuppurchased marinara sauce
2cupscooked white riceI use Uncle Ben's Ready Rice which cooks in 90 seconds)
3bell peppers (red, green, yellow or combination)halved vertically with stems & seeds removed
chopped fresh basil, if desired
Instructions
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Heat oil in a large nonstick skillet and saute onion until tender, about 5 minutes. Add garlic and saute 1 additional minute. Add sausage, crumbling it as it cooks until no pink remains.While sausage is cooking, fill a Dutch oven with water deep enough to cover pepper halves and bring to boil. Blanch pepper halves for 5 minutes (I cooked my peppers in 2 batches.) Place blanched peppers on a cutting board to cool briefly. Note – the end result after baking will be a crisp-tender pepper.If you prefer a softer pepper, blanch for a few additional minutes.Add Parmesan, marinara sauce and prepared rice to the cooked sausage mixture and stir well to combine. Stuff mixture into pepper halves and place in baking dish. Pour water into the dish to a depth of about 1 inch. Bake peppers for 30 minutes. Garnish with fresh chopped basil if desired.
Notes
This recipe is based on a single pepper half as a serving. However, I would suggest an entire pepper per person for more hearty appetites.
